A piece of her heart remains in Paris… But at last the time has come to make a magical journey into the past—because now Juliet is free from family obligations.
What to take with you? Perhaps her favorite red lipstick, a vintage silk scarf, a love novel in French, and a notebook filled with memories to bring them back to life on the streets, squares, and boulevards of the famous City of Lights. Juliet has thirty days in Paris to fulfill her dream and write a book dedicated to herself—twenty-year-old, naive, and in love. What happened back then, a quarter of a century ago—and why did she suddenly leave the city that gave her new friends and hope for happiness? Juliet needs to manage a lot in such a short time, but no matter what happens, she is certain: Paris is always a good idea…
